Decision cooling period: wait 2 hours before major actions to let FOMO naturally die down


⏳ When you see a big market move and you feel an intense urge to rush in immediately, set a rule for yourself: force yourself to wait 2 hours.
Why wait?
Because emotions have a half-life. The impulse you feel right now will often fade by half after 2 hours.
During these 2 hours, you can grab a glass of water, or review historical price action. If after 2 hours you still think this trade makes sense, then it’s not too late to act.
